On 3/20/06, Miguel Benítez <[EMAIL PROTECTED]> wrote: > body{ font-family: Arial, Helvetica, sans-serif; font-size:62%; > color:#676767; } > > He leido por ahí en diversas ocasiones que el font-size:62,5% resetea el > tamaño de fuente a un equivalente a 10px. En mi caso no lo he conseguido > poniendo a 62,5% pero si a 62%.
<tono class="radical"> Eso es una barbaridad y quienes recomiendan este método unos inconscientes. </tono> Me explico: asignar un tamaño de fuente de X% en el `body` significa que el tamaño base para la fuente del documento será un X por ciento del tamaño que por defecto haya escogido el usuario. Por defecto, los navegadores (no sé si todos) vienen configurados con un tamaño de fuente _base_ de 16px. En tal caso, asignar un tamaño de fuente de 62.5% [^1] hará que el tamaño base del texto de nuestro documento sea de 10px. Ahora bien, ¿qué ganamos? Ná de ná. Si vamos a tener en cuenta el tamaño de fuente escogido por el usuario (en caso de que lo haya escogido), deberíamos establecer nuestro tamaño base como 100%. Cualquier otra cosa es ir en contra del usuario. Así pues, ¿de qué tamaño queremos el texto? ¿10px [^2]? Pues dejémonos de porcentajes sobre valores _desconocidos_ y escribamos body { font-size: 10px; } **Todos** los navegadores, excepto IE, pueden redimensionar tamaños de fuente definidos en píxeles. Lo que nos deja un problema por resolver: permitir a los usuarios de IE el redimensionamiento del texto. Aquí sí que me parece justificado [^3] utilizar * html body { font-size: 62.5%; } Quede este asunto abierto para debate. [^1]: 10 / 16 * 100 [^2]: 10 px es un tamaño de texto pequeño, muy pequeño, diminuto dependiendo de si somos jóvenes, no tan jóvenes o mayorzotes (y eso sin tener en cuenta los posibles defectos visuales no relacionados con la edad). [^3]: No tan justificado, véase [^2]. Salud, Choan
_______________________________________________ Lista de distribución Ovillo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org Puedes modificar tus datos o desuscribirte en la siguiente dirección: http://ovillo.org/mailman/listinfo/ovillo